🖇️ Prompt Chaining

Have you ever tried to tackle a big task and felt overwhelmed by its complexity? You’re not alone. Whether it’s planning a family vacation, writing an essay, or solving a tricky problem, breaking it down into smaller, manageable steps often makes the process easier and more effective. This simple yet powerful approach is at the heart of prompt chaining when interacting with large language models.

What is Prompt Chaining?

Prompt chaining is a method of engaging with AI language models by asking a series of connected questions, where each question, or prompt, builds upon the previous one. Instead of posing one big, complex question and hoping for a comprehensive answer, you guide the AI step-by-step through the problem or task at hand.

Think of it as having a thoughtful conversation with a knowledgeable assistant who helps you navigate through each part of your task, ensuring that all aspects are considered and addressed thoroughly.

Why Use Prompt Chaining?

1. Simplifies Complex Tasks

Breaking down a large task into smaller parts makes it less daunting. By focusing on one aspect at a time, both you and the AI can concentrate better on the details without getting overwhelmed.

2. Enhances Clarity and Detail

Each prompt targets a specific piece of information, encouraging the AI to provide detailed and precise responses. This leads to more accurate and useful outcomes.

3. Improves Coherence and Relevance

Since each step builds on the previous one, the AI can maintain context throughout the conversation. This continuity ensures that all responses are relevant and connected to your overall goal.

4. Offers Flexibility

Prompt chaining allows you to adjust your approach as new information emerges. You can delve deeper into certain areas, skip others, or change direction entirely based on the AI’s responses.

A Practical Example: Planning a Family Vacation

Let’s bring the concept to life with a relatable scenario: planning a family vacation. Here’s how prompt chaining can assist you in this process.

(Keep in mind that this example works best with an LLM that can search the web, so that the information is more accurate and up-to-date.)

Step 1: Choosing a Destination

Prompt:

“We want to go on a fun family vacation in the summer. What are some good destinations for a family with young kids?”

AI’s Response:

"Some great family-friendly destinations in the summer include:

  • Theme Parks: Disneyland or Disney World offer magical experiences for kids.
  • Beach Resorts: Places like Florida or California have beautiful beaches and family-oriented resorts.
  • National Parks: Yellowstone or the Grand Canyon provide adventure and educational opportunities.
  • Cruise Trips: Family cruises offer activities for all ages and convenient travel."

Step 2: Narrowing Down Choices

Prompt:

“We love the idea of a beach resort in Florida. What activities can we do there with young kids?”

AI’s Response:

"At a beach resort in Florida, your family can:

  • Build sandcastles and enjoy the beach.
  • Swim or paddle in the ocean’s shallow areas.
  • Visit nearby aquariums or marine parks to learn about sea life.
  • Take boat tours to see dolphins and other wildlife.
  • Participate in resort activities like kids’ clubs and family games.
  • Explore local attractions such as zoos and interactive museums."

Step 3: Selecting Accommodation

Prompt:

“Can you recommend some family-friendly beach resorts in Florida that have good reviews and are affordable?”

AI’s Response:

"Certainly! Here are a few options:

  1. Sunshine Beach Resort: Known for its excellent kids’ program and spacious family suites.
  2. Oceanview All-Inclusive Resort: Offers packages that include meals and a variety of activities.
  3. Wavecrest Resort & Water Park: Features an on-site water park and is close to local attractions.

These resorts are praised for being clean, safe, and fun for families while remaining reasonably priced."

Step 4: Budgeting

Prompt:

“How much would a one-week stay at one of these resorts cost for a family of four, including meals and activities?”

AI’s Response:

"Here’s a rough estimate for a family of four for one week:

  • Sunshine Beach Resort: Approximately $2,500, including breakfast and complimentary activities.
  • Oceanview All-Inclusive Resort: Around $3,000, covering all meals and many activities.
  • Wavecrest Resort & Water Park: About $2,200, with additional costs for certain activities and meals.

Prices may vary based on the time of booking and available promotions."

Step 5: Travel Tips

Prompt:

“What are some tips for traveling with young kids to make the trip easier and more enjoyable?”

AI’s Response:

"Here are some helpful tips:

  • Pack Essentials: Bring snacks, toys, and extra clothing in your carry-on bag.
  • Plan Downtime: Don’t over-schedule; allow time for rest and spontaneous fun.
  • Entertainment: Have books, games, or a tablet handy for travel time.
  • Stay Prepared: Carry sunscreen, hats, and other items for sun protection.
  • Be Flexible: Be ready to adapt plans based on your children’s needs and energy levels."

The Benefits Illustrated

In this example, prompt chaining:

  • Simplified the Planning: By addressing one aspect at a time, from destination choice to budgeting.
  • Provided Specific Information: Each response was tailored to the prompt, giving detailed and actionable advice.
  • Maintained Context: The AI remembered previous prompts, ensuring continuity and relevance.
  • Enhanced Engagement: The step-by-step approach made the planning process more interactive and less overwhelming.

Applying Prompt Chaining in Everyday Life

Prompt chaining isn’t limited to vacation planning. It can be applied to various tasks, such as:

  • Writing Projects: Outlining an essay or article by sequentially developing ideas.
  • Learning New Topics: Breaking down complex subjects into understandable segments.
  • Problem Solving: Tackling challenges step-by-step to find solutions.
  • Decision Making: Weighing options by exploring each factor individually.

Tips for Effective Prompt Chaining

  1. Start with a Clear Goal: Know what you want to achieve so you can guide the conversation effectively.
  2. Break It Down: Divide the main task into smaller, logical steps.
  3. Be Specific: Craft prompts that target particular pieces of information.
  4. Build on Responses: Use the AI’s answers as a foundation for the next prompt.
  5. Stay Flexible: Don’t hesitate to adjust your prompts based on new insights from the AI.

Conclusion

Prompt chaining is a powerful tool that transforms how we interact with AI language models. By guiding the AI through a series of connected prompts, we can unlock more detailed, accurate, and useful responses. This method makes complex tasks more approachable and enhances the overall experience of working with AI.

Next time you face a big project or problem, remember the power of prompt chaining. Break it down, engage step-by-step, and let the conversation with AI lead you to effective solutions.


Remember: Prompt chaining is like having a thoughtful dialogue with a knowledgeable friend. It’s not just about getting answers but about exploring possibilities, gaining insights, and making informed decisions — all through a collaborative and incremental approach.